Output 43216f91c257c6905318c18e614273c131030e4bcefd1219a821fd39b28b2872:1

value
3390000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 925a8ee86fcc7ad175917392c981d7174bcbab0d OP_EQUAL
address
3F2s4eWAAGPshA1dwo3Prddf5p3LnutGva
transaction
43216f91c257c6905318c18e614273c131030e4bcefd1219a821fd39b28b2872